…and Next Year
Following Storm King’s extraordinary outdoor exhibit of sculpture this summer, the Smithsonian’s Cooper-Hewitt National Design Museum will stage an extraordinary indoor exhibit of graphic design in summer 2012. Planting an Oyster Reef
Placing rock and shell material in Buttermilk Channel just offshore from Governors Island on October 6. This was the first step in a project to determine if oyster reefs can be restored to the harbor, where they once flourished. Collaborating … Continue reading
